No Time To Die
James Bond ( Daniel Craig) is enjoying a
tranquil life in Jamaica after leaving active service.
However, his peace is short lived as his old CIA friend,
Felix Leiter, shows up and asks for help. The mission to
rescue a kidnapped scientist (Rami Melek)
turns out to be far more treacherous than expected,
leading Bond on the trail of a mysterious villain who's
armed with a dangerous new technology. The movie has all
of the classic ingredients of a James Bond
movie: great action, beautiful cars, mystery, romance...
but even if the story runs on the same principles: hero
vs villain, the background evolves. The characters are
surprisingly more gender balanced, with strong female
representatives. Bond himself has evolved a lot during
the past movies, but this one delivers the best
performance.

The Movies That Made Us
(Netflix)
Created by the same passionate team that produced the
three-season documentary series The Toys
That Made Us for Netflix,
The Movies That Made Us has quickly become one of the
best-rated documentary projects on the streaming
service. The show uses a combination of informative
interviews, humorous narration, and comedic editing to
pull back the curtain on some of the most cherished
films to come from the 1980s and 1990s. Netflix's new
trailer for The Movies That Made Us season 3 reveals the
eight new titles under investigation, many of which are
staples of the horror genre. This includes A
Nightmare on Elm Street, Friday the 13th, and
Halloween, three slashers that introduced some of
Hollywood's biggest bogeymen and birthed long-running
franchises.

The Starling (Netflix)
After Lilly (Melissa McCarthy) suffers a
loss, a combative Starling takes nest beside her quiet
home. The feisty bird taunts and attacks the
grief-stricken Lilly. On her journey to expel the
Starling, she rediscovers her will to live and capacity
for love. If you’ve been hurt by loss and have felt the
sting of mental health issues, you’ll get this movie’s
point. Kevin Klein, Melissa McCarthy and
Chris O’Dowd play their rolls honestly and
convincingly.

Amazon has licensed Hotel Transylvania: Transformania from Sony
Pictures Animation. The fourth (and final) installment in the
blockbuster franchise will stream globally, excluding China, on Prime Video on
Jan. 14, 2022. The first Hotel Transylvania movie was released in 2012, and the
series has grossed more than $1.3 billion worldwide.

Dave Chappelle is drawing a growing wave of criticism for his
derogatory comments about the LGBTQ+ community in his newest Netflix
stand-up special. The special, titled The Closer, premiered on the
streamer on Tuesday and is meant to serve as a final entry in a series of
stand-up routines by Chappelle on Netflix. In the new release, the comedian
makes explicit jokes about trans women and offers defenses for previous
derogatory comments made by figures such as Harry Potter author
J.K. Rowling and rapper DaBaby.
